About Skyviews Life Science
Skyviews Life Science is a venture capital firm founded in 2018. It is primarily based out of Grandvaux, France. As of Dec 2024, Skyviews Life Science has invested in 19 companies. It primarily invests in Series B round in United States based startups. Its investments are spread across a wide range of sectors from Life Sciences to High Tech and Food and Agriculture Tech. Most recently it participated in the $***** Series A round of One bio Overall, Skyviews Life Science portfolio has seen 4 IPOs including key companies like Siemens Healthineers, COMPASS Pathways and Beyond Meat. A lot of funds co-invest with Skyviews Life Science, with names like Leaps by Bayer sharing a substantial percentage of its portfolio. 4. Aleph Farms
Develops lab-cultured meat products using beef cells. Its product offerings include ground meat, beef burger patties, steaks, etc. The company uses proprietary 3D bioprinting technologies by using fat cells, support cells, muscle cells, and blood vessel cells to develop tissues and further into meat products. Claims that the process takes 3 weeks to develop the meat in bioreactors.

5. Cellares
Manufacturer of a medical device for cell-based therapy. The company offers Cell Shuttle integrates all the technologies required for the entire manufacturing process in a flexible and high-throughput platform that delivers true walk-away, end-to-end automation. It also, offers software suite for cell therapy modalities.
